The AI Creative Tools Space: From "Does It Exist?" to "Is It Actually Good?"
As the capabilities of large language models (LLMs) continue to leap forward, AI writing assistants and tools centered on content creation, code generation, and creative support are proliferating. Foundation models like GPT-4, Claude, and Gemini — pre-trained on massive text corpora and refined through instruction fine-tuning — already possess impressive language understanding and generation capabilities. However, calling these models via API is merely the starting point for building a product. What truly determines user experience is how you build application-layer capabilities on top of model power: prompt engineering, context window management, output formatting, and personalized memory. From Notion AI to countless indie developers' side projects, this space has entered deep waters — the competition is no longer about "can you call AI" but "is the experience genuinely good."
Differentiation Is the Core Competitive Moat
For AI creative tools like Muse Spark, simply integrating a large model API is no longer a competitive barrier. Real differentiation shows up across three dimensions:
- Interaction experience: AI capabilities need to flow naturally into the creative process rather than abruptly disrupting a user's train of thought. This involves latency perception optimization for streaming output and context-aware smart triggering logic;
- Response speed: The right balance between local processing and cloud-based inference directly determines user retention. The maturation of edge inference technology means some lightweight models can run on local devices, significantly reducing latency;
- Scenario focus: Rather than building a broad, general-purpose tool, going deep on a specific creative scenario and establishing a unique advantage pays off. Vertical-scenario-specific data and workflow design often deliver experience gains that general-purpose models simply can't replicate.

The Product Thinking Behind Version Iteration
Building a User Feedback Loop Through Agile Iteration
The rapid transition from 1.0 to 1.1 typically encompasses performance optimization, bug fixes, UI/UX detail polishing, and feature tweaks based on early user feedback. This agile release cadence allows a product to establish a tight feedback loop with users early on. In software engineering, this idea traces back to the core value in the Agile Manifesto of "responding to change over following a plan," further systematized in Eric Ries's Lean Startup methodology — using a minimum viable product (MVP), measuring user behavior data, and iterating quickly to create a Build-Measure-Learn flywheel.
For indie developers or small teams, this approach is especially important. With limited resources, making continuous small improvements to gradually converge on the product form users actually need is far more efficient than building in isolation — and far better at capturing fleeting market windows.
Hacker News: A Natural Hub for Early Users
Choosing to launch on Hacker News is itself a precise cold-start strategy. The platform attracts a high concentration of early adopters and technical thought leaders. In Everett Rogers's Diffusion of Innovations theory, early adopters are the critical population for crossing the "chasm" and driving a product from the geek cohort into the mainstream market. Their feedback is high quality, their reach is strong, and public discussions about a product often ripple out to broader tech media and communities. An AI productivity tool that earns positive discussion here typically gains its first batch of high-quality seed users along with genuinely valuable improvement suggestions.

Takeaways for Creators and Indie Developers
For Creators: Treat AI Tools as Amplifiers, Not Replacements
If you're looking for an AI-assisted tool to boost your creative efficiency, Muse Spark 1.1 is worth adding to your trial list. It's worth maintaining realistic expectations — the value of AI creative tools lies in amplifying human creativity and execution efficiency, not replacing human judgment and aesthetic sensibility. From a cognitive science perspective, AI excels at "convergent thinking" tasks (such as text polishing, format standardization, and information retrieval), while human "divergent thinking" and emotional resonance remain the core barriers in content creation. The creator themselves is always the one who ultimately produces great content.
For Indie Developers: Deep Scene Understanding Matters More Than Being First to Integrate
Muse Spark's iteration path offers a valuable product case study: in an era when AI tools are highly commoditized, success depends not on being the first to integrate the latest large model, but on deeply understanding a specific niche scenario and responding quickly to user feedback. The technical moat has been significantly lowered in the era of large models — what's truly hard to replicate is deep embedding in users' workflows and the accumulation of scenario-specific data. Identifying the real pain point and polishing relentlessly is the right way to break through.
